Easter Seals 'LemondAid Stand' fundraiser features food

Grab a cup of lemonade this Friday and help out a good cause.  The 18th annual “LemonAid Stand for Easter Seals” will be held June 21 from 11 a.m. - 1:30 p.m. at the Easter Seals Rehabilitation Center, 3701 Bellemeade Ave.

Thirteen-year-old Owen George is coordinating this year’s event, with assistance from his parents, Art and Mindy George, and sister, Alex.  All funds raised will be donated to the Easter Seals Rehabilitation Center to provide physical, occupational and speech therapy for local children and adults with disabilities.

Wash your car; help those in the Tri-State with MS

The Tri-State Multiple Sclerosis Association will have a benefit car wash at Lucas Oil Center this Saturday.  

From 7:00am to 4:00pm, participants will receive a Free Express Works Wash with a donation to support the local Tri-State Multiple Sclerosis Association.

All money raised at this fundraising event stays in the tri-state area to support individuals and families coping with Multiple Sclerosis.

Stanton Optical partners with ECHO Community Health Care for free eye exams

Stanton Optical's North Green River Road store recently partnered with ECHO Community Health Care to accept eye exam referrals for uninsured, under insured and homeless patients. Stanton Optical provides the patients with a free eye examination and a copy of their eyeglass prescription to take back to their counselor at ECHO.

Teens, parents invited to Girls Power the World event

 

All girls in grades 9-12 (as well as incoming freshmen and recent graduates) and parents are invited to attend a Girls Power the World event on Saturday, June 15, 7:30 a.m.-12:30 p.m. Central Time, at the University of Evansville’s Ridgeway University Center.  This event is designed to help girls build skills and attitudes that will give them the confidence they need to move successfully through the high school years and as they enter college and pursue a career. 

Girls Power the World was developed and organized by Castle High School senior Mary Lynn Dennis, as her Girl Scout Gold Award Project. The Girl Scout Gold Award, the highest achievement in Girl Scouting, requires completion of a Take Action Project that addresses a community need and seeks to produce lasting, positive sustainable change through involving others in the effort.

Put non-perishable food by your mailbox for NALC drive this Saturday

 

The National Association of Letter Carriers (NALC) will conduct its 21st annual food drive to combat hunger on Saturday, May 11. Letter carriers will collect non-perishable food donations on that day as they deliver mail along their postal routes in Evansville and the surrounding area.

Law enforcement officers work for tips to benefit Special Olympics Friday at Texas Roadhouse

 

Cops and Cowboys is scheduled for this Friday April 26 at Texas Roadhouse in Evansville Indiana.  Law Enforcement Officers from the Evansville City Police Department, Vanderburgh County Sheriffs Deputies and Vanderburgh Confinement Officers with be assisting the wait staff to collect tips for Special Olympics.  All proceeds will benefit local athletes. 

You can come by for lunch and dinner, meet our local heroes and help a worthy cause.
